Major Cybersecurity M&A Deals in January 2026

Major Cybersecurity M&A Deals in January 2026

Posted on February 9, 2026 By CWS

In January 2026, the cybersecurity sector witnessed a significant wave of merger and acquisition (M&A) activities, with a total of 34 deals announced. This follows a year where over 420 such transactions were recorded in 2025, indicating a continuing trend of consolidation and strategic growth within the industry.

Notable among these developments is CrowdStrike’s acquisition strategy. The company, listed on NASDAQ as CRWD, has entered into a definitive agreement to acquire two firms: the US-based SGNL, known for its continuous identity and dynamic authorization solutions, and Israel-based Seraphic Security, which specializes in browser runtime security. These acquisitions, valued at $740 million and $420 million respectively, aim to bolster CrowdStrike’s Falcon platform by integrating advanced web and AI interaction security features.

Delinea and Infoblox Strengthen Their Portfolios

Delinea, a firm specializing in privileged access management (PAM) and identity security, is in the process of acquiring StrongDM. This acquisition is intended to enhance Delinea’s capabilities by combining PAM with just-in-time runtime authorization and universal access management, targeting improvements for hybrid and cloud environments.

Meanwhile, Infoblox has set its sights on Brazil-based Axur, a provider of external threat protection. This strategic move aims to improve Infoblox’s ability to detect and mitigate brand abuse, phishing, and other fraudulent activities, enhancing its preemptive security offerings.

Strategic Acquisitions by JumpCloud and Diligent

JumpCloud, a platform focused on identity and device management, has acquired MacSolution, a managed service provider based in Brazil. This acquisition is part of JumpCloud’s efforts to establish a strategic hub in São Paulo, which is expected to accelerate IT modernization and enhance enterprise readiness.

In another significant move, Diligent, a governance, risk, and compliance (GRC) company, acquired 3rdRisk from the Netherlands. This acquisition is designed to integrate automated vendor due diligence and AI-driven assessments into Diligent’s offerings, enhancing risk management visibility from the boardroom to the supply chain.

Expanding Horizons for OneSpan, OVHcloud, and Radware

OneSpan, which focuses on authentication and mobile security, plans to acquire Munich-based Build38. This acquisition aims to expand OneSpan’s App Shielding capabilities with advanced in-app and AI-integrated technologies, offering improved mobile threat protection.

OVHcloud, a major European cloud provider, has acquired Seald, a Paris-based company specializing in end-to-end encryption. This acquisition is expected to integrate Seald’s encryption solutions directly into OVHcloud’s service offerings, enhancing data security.

Radware, known for application and API security, has acquired Israeli startup Pynt. This acquisition is set to enhance Radware’s API security portfolio with Pynt’s automated testing and vulnerability discovery capabilities, providing comprehensive protection throughout the API lifecycle.

Future Implications and Industry Outlook

The series of acquisitions announced in January 2026 underscores the dynamic nature of the cybersecurity industry as companies seek to fortify their positions and expand their technological capabilities. These strategic moves are likely to influence the competitive landscape, drive innovation, and improve security solutions for businesses globally.

As the industry continues to evolve, stakeholders anticipate further consolidation and technological advancements that will shape the future of cybersecurity. The ongoing focus on integrating advanced security measures and enhancing operational efficiencies will play a crucial role in addressing the ever-growing challenges posed by cyber threats.
